Trees, Grasses, Forbs and Soil:  The ranch is located where the Post Oak Savannah and Piney Woods regions of Texas converge.  With approx. 210+/- acres of native and planted timber, the tree species include varieties of Live Oaks, White Oaks, Post Oak, Hickory and Cedar together with native and planted Pine timber.  An abundance of native browse and forbs compliment wildlife production.  The ranch consists of 250+/- acres of native and improved pastures.  Most pastures have an abundance of Coastal Bermuda, Tifton 85, and clover together with native grasses such as Little Bluestem and bunch grasses.  The ranch is fenced and cross-fenced into multiple pastures for rotational grazing, hay production and wildlife food plots for wildlife production. The majority of the property's upland terrain is dominated by Redsprings sandy loam while Elrose and Kirvin Loams dominate pastures and middle elevations on the property.  Owentown and Attoyac loam can be found in the lower elevations and within the creek drainages.

Water:   A well positioned 2.7+/- acre lake and 1.5+/- bass pond are located in the Northwest portion of the ranch adjacent to the "Headquarters Barn.The lake fishes very well for Largemouth Bass.  The ranch boasts surface water from east to west with additional ponds up to 1+/- surface acre in size.  There are also multiple stock tanks interspersed through the property.  Two tributaries from Rock Creek flow through the property moving south from the northeast and northwest corners.  A total of three water wells provide water to the improvements on the ranch. The Carrizo - Wilcox is the major aquifer under the property.

Topography: The ranch has excellent topography with well-drained soils and only 14+/- acres located within the FEMA floodplain.  The highest point on the property is approximately 650' ASL near the main home eventually sloping down to the lowest point just below 420' ASL on the northwest portion of the ranch.
